Obituary of Senia Inglin

Senia Bloomstrand Inglin (neé Senia Edith Augusta Anna Bloomstrand) passed away in Boise at age 95 on July 1, 2022.

 

     Senia is survived by her five children: Sonja (William Strausz), Steve, Ingrid (Robert Warden), Raymond Jr. (Cindy), Damian (Kathryn); and seven grandchildren: Samuel Strausz (Natasha), Cassandra Inglin, Robert Warden, Anna Warden, Grace Inglin, Liliana Inglin, and Luca Inglin. Senia was predeceased by her husband,Raymond Damian Inglin (2016) and her two sisters: Anna (2009) and Greta (2017).

 

     Born to Swedish immigrant parents, Samuel and Anna Bloomstrand, in Barber, and raised in the Lutheran faith, Senia graduated from Boise High School, attended Boise Junior College (now Boise State University), and graduated from Idaho State University. After teaching high school in Echo, Oregon, Senia married Raymond Damian Inglin on August 30, 1953 at Sacred Heart Catholic Church in Boise. Senia and Ray lived in Salinas then Los Angeles before settling in Whittier, California where they raised their five children. They ultimately returned to Boise.

     

     Affectionately known to her grandchildren as “Mormor” (mother’s mother) or “Farmor” (father’s mother) from the Swedish, Senia is remembered by her children for her love for her husband Raymond, “Big Ray”, and devotion to the happiness, health, and success of her children. Senia was also known for her quick wit, love of Swedish culture and traditions, and enjoyment of conversation over coffee and sweets.
